Job Description
ABOUT THIS JOB
The role will provide data-driven and analytical support for global and local clients from FMCG and Tech & Durables industries. An Insight Analyst will be responsible for one or several clients, working closely with internal stakeholders from client-facing NIQ teams, operating as part of a broader international community, and contributing proactively to supporting clients in achieving their strategic business objectives through high‑quality insights and analysis.
RESPONSIBILITIES
Supporting internal NIQ stakeholders (Consultants, Account Development, local Insights Teams etc.) in their day-to-day work with the client by:
Leading and executing projects by extracting, compiling, analyzing, and interpreting sales and consumer data, visualizing it, and building clear insight‑driven presentations.
Producing and validating data summaries in tables, charts, and graphs, ensuring accuracy, consistency, and analytical robustness of deliverables.
Drafting reports and presentations with clear data interpretation and recommendations (varying levels of complexity), tailored to client and stakeholder needs.
Actively identifying and sharing best practice examples, opportunities for optimization and automation, and implementing improved approaches in day‑to‑day work.
Contributing to preparation for client meetings and presentations, providing analytical input, key messages, and supporting materials.

QUALIFICATIONS
Graduate (Bachelor/Master) of Marketing, Business, Economics, Mathematics, Statistics or a related field
Strong numerical, analytical, and written presentation skills
Advanced knowledge of Microsoft Excel (pivot tables, lookups, conditional functions, data validation, advanced charting) and PowerPoint
Fluent communication in English – verbal and written (at least C1 level)
Fluency in French, German, Spanish or Italian is an asset (at least B2 level)
Results‑oriented mindset and ability to manage multiple priorities and deadlines
Strong interpersonal skills in a multicultural setting
Ability to build trusted relationships with internal stakeholders and readiness for client‑facing interactions
Strong time‑ and workload management skills
Ability to work independently while contributing effectively as a team player
Comfortable working in a virtual and international environment
Strong interest in the FMCG and/or T&D industry

About NIQ
NIQ is the world’s leading consumer intelligence company, delivering the most complete understanding of consumer buying behavior and revealing new pathways to growth. In 2023, NIQ combined with GfK, bringing together the two industry leaders with unparalleled global reach. With a holistic retail read and the most comprehensive consumer insights—delivered with advanced analytics through state-of-the-art platforms—NIQ delivers the Full View™. NIQ is an Advent International portfolio company with operations in 100+ markets, covering more than 90% of the world’s population.
